1. Key Laboratory for Precision and Non-Traditional Machining Technology of Ministry of Education, Dalian University of Technology, No. 2 Linggong Road, Dalian, Liaoning Province 116024, China
2. School of Mechanical and Systems Engineering, Newcastle University, Newcastle Upon Tyne NE1 7RU, UK